As of September 2026, the MLS records 5 closed sales in Clevelands in Jacksonville, FL since 2003, the most recent in July 2025. Across Jacksonville as a whole, 8,846 homes closed in the last 12 months at a median of $305,375, 44 median days on market, with 2,385 homes for sale today. At that median and Duval County's FY2025-26 rate of 17.86 mills, annual property tax runs about $5,460 ($4,720 with the full homestead exemption).

The market around Clevelands

Clevelands is too small for its own price trend, so here is the market around it.

In ZIP 32209, 278 homes are on the market and 23% are under contract — a steady corner of Jacksonville.

Across Duval County, 3,937 homes are active and 1,726 pending (30% under contract).

ZIP and county figures describe the wider market, not Clevelands specifically. Momentum Research analysis of MLS records.

Reading a thin market

In a community this size, the usual metrics — median price, days on market, months of supply — are too sparse to swing decisions on. What matters instead is the direct comparison: two houses on the same street can carry very different values based on renovation, lot, and layout alone. Expect a wide spread that has more to do with condition than location.

That's not a weakness so much as a reason to do your homework. When there aren't dozens of recent sales to average out, a single well-informed comp read is worth more than a market-wide statistic. This is a place where a careful, listing-by-listing analysis beats any headline number.
